Delhi Bachelorette Party Itinerary

Saturday, August 5: Arrival in Delhi

Welcome to Delhi, the vibrant capital city of India! After checking in at your hotel, start your bachelorette party weekend by exploring the bustling markets of Chandni Chowk in Old Delhi. In the morning, indulge in delicious street food and shop for traditional Indian attire and accessories. In the afternoon, visit the majestic Red Fort and immerse yourself in the rich history of the Mughal era. As the evening sets in, head to Hauz Khas Village, a trendy neighbourhood known for its buzzing nightlife, chic bars, and restaurants.

  • Chandni Chowk: Price varies, 3-4 hours
  • Red Fort: INR 35 per person (approx. $0.50), 2-3 hours
  • Hauz Khas Village: Price varies, evening
Sunday, August 6: Cultural Delights

Start your day with a visit to the iconic India Gate, a war memorial dedicated to soldiers. Enjoy a leisurely picnic in the surrounding lawns and capture beautiful photographs. In the afternoon, explore the tranquil beauty of Lodhi Gardens, known for its historic tombs and lush greenery. As the evening approaches, experience the vibrant art and cultural scene of Delhi at the Kingdom of Dreams, a theatrical extravaganza showcasing India's diverse heritage.

  • India Gate: Free, 2-3 hours
  • Lodhi Gardens: Free, 2-3 hours
  • Kingdom of Dreams: Price varies, evening
Monday, August 7: Shopping Extravaganza

Delhi is a shopper's paradise, so dedicate this day to exploring its famous markets. Begin at Dilli Haat, a vibrant open-air bazaar offering traditional handicrafts and regional delicacies. In the afternoon, head to Khan Market, known for its trendy boutiques, bookstores, and cafes. As the evening sets in, visit the upscale Select Citywalk Mall in Saket for high-end shopping and entertainment.

  • Dilli Haat: Price varies, 3-4 hours
  • Khan Market: Price varies, 2-3 hours
  • Select Citywalk Mall: Price varies, evening
Tuesday, August 8: Historical Marvels

Embark on a historical journey by visiting two UNESCO World Heritage Sites in Delhi. Start your morning with a visit to Qutub Minar, the world's tallest brick minaret, surrounded by ancient ruins. In the afternoon, explore Humayun's Tomb, a magnificent Mughal mausoleum known for its intricate architecture. As the evening approaches, enjoy a serene boat ride at the beautiful Lodi Gardens.

  • Qutub Minar: INR 40 per person (approx. $0.60), 2-3 hours
  • Humayun's Tomb: INR 35 per person (approx. $0.50), 2-3 hours
  • Lodi Gardens: Free, evening

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

For a unique experience, consider taking a hot air balloon ride over the city at sunrise. This breathtaking adventure will provide panoramic views of Delhi's iconic landmarks. Another local favorite is exploring the street art scene in the hip neighbourhood of Shahpur Jat, where you can find artistic murals and graffiti adorning the walls. End your trip by indulging in a traditional Indian cooking class where you can learn to prepare delicious local dishes.
